    • 12 The Regulations are amended by adding the following after section 1.18:

      Class 7, Radioactive Materials, Medical Purposes
      • 1.18.1 These Regulations do not apply to the offering for transport, handling or transporting of dangerous goods included in Class 7 on a road vehicle, a railway vehicle or a vessel on a domestic voyage

        • (a) that have been implanted in or administered to an individual or animal for medical diagnosis or treatment purposes or that subsist in their remains;

        • (b) that are contained in a sample of material taken for bioassay purposes;

        • (c) that are contained in human or animal tissue samples, animal remains or a liquid scintillation medium, as set out in paragraph 2(2)(e) of the Packaging and Transport of Nuclear Substances Regulations, 2015; or

        • (d) that are in or on an individual who is transported for medical treatment because the individual has been subject to an accidental or deliberate intake or contamination.

    • 36 Section 1.35 of the Regulations, the heading before it and the heading after it are replaced by the following:

      UN1202, DIESEL FUEL or UN1203, GASOLINE
      • 1.35 Part 3, sections 4.12 and 4.15.2 and Parts 6 and 17 do not apply to the offering for transport, handling or transporting, on a road vehicle, of dangerous goods that are UN1202, DIESEL FUEL or UN1203, GASOLINE, if

        • (a) the dangerous goods are in one or more means of containment;

        • (b) each means of containment has at least one label or placard that is visible from outside the road vehicle during transport;

        • (c) each means of containment is secured to the road vehicle to prevent unintended movement during transport; and

        • (d) the total capacity of the means of containment is less than or equal to 2 000 L.

    • 47 Section 1.44 of the Regulations is replaced by the following:

      Radioactive Materials — Unknown Classification
      • 1.43.1 Parts 2 to 7, 9 and 17 do not apply to the offering for transport, handling or transporting of goods that include radioactive materials whose classification is unknown and cannot be readily determined, and that satisfy the conditions set out in paragraph 2(2)(n) or (o) of the Packaging and Transport of Nuclear Substances Regulations, 2015.

      Residues of Dangerous Goods in a Drum or IBC
      • 1.44 Parts 2 to 4, 7 and 17 do not apply to a residue contained in a drum or an IBC, except for a residue of dangerous goods included in Packing Group I or in Class 1, 4.3, 6.2 or 7, if

        • (a) in the case of a residue contained in a drum,

          • (i) the drum is being transported to a facility for the purpose of reconditioning, remanufacturing or repair in accordance with CGSB-43.150,

          • (ii) the drum is accompanied by a document that includes the primary class of each residue and the words “Residue Drum(s)” or “fût(s) de résidu”, preceded by the number of drums containing dangerous goods in that primary class, and

          • (iii) if more than 10 drums are on a road vehicle or railway vehicle, the DANGER placard is displayed on each side and each end of the vehicle in accordance with Part 4, except for section 4.16; and

        • (b) in the case of a residue contained in an IBC,

          • (i) the IBC is being transported to a facility for the purpose of conducting IBC leak tests and inspections in accordance with CGSB-43.146,

          • (ii) the IBC is accompanied by a document that includes the primary class of each residue and the words “Residue IBC(s)” or “GRV de résidu”, preceded by the number of IBCs containing dangerous goods in that primary class, and

          • (iii) if an IBC is on a road vehicle or railway vehicle, the DANGER placard is displayed on each side and each end of the vehicle in accordance with Part 4, except for section 4.16.

    • 70 Sections 16.2 to 16.5 of the Regulations are replaced by the following:

      • 16.2 A certificate issued by an inspector to a person under subsection 16.1(1) of the Act must include the following information:

        • (a) the seal number of any seal removed from a means of containment;

        • (b) the seal number of any new seal applied to a means of containment after the inspection or sampling;

        • (c) the UN number, shipping name and quantity of any dangerous goods subject to inspection or sampling;

        • (d) the quantity of any sample taken;

        • (e) a description of any means of containment opened and, if applicable, the serial number of the means of containment;

        • (f) a description of the means of transport used or to be used;

        • (g) the name, contact information and signature of the person to whom the certificate is issued;

        • (h) the name, certificate of designation number and signature of the inspector issuing the certificate; and

        • (i) the geographic location and date of the inspection or sampling.

        • 16.3 (1) An inspector who, under subsection 17(1) of the Act, detains dangerous goods or a means of containment must issue a notice of detention to the person who has the charge, management or control of the dangerous goods or means of containment. The notice must include the following information:

          • (a) the UN number and shipping name of any dangerous goods detained;

          • (b) a description of any means of containment detained and, if applicable, the serial number of the means of containment;

          • (c) a description of any non-compliance, including the applicable references to the Act and these Regulations;

          • (d) the name and contact information of the person to whom the notice is issued;

          • (e) the name, certificate of designation number and signature of the inspector issuing the notice;

          • (f) the geographic location where the notice is issued; and

          • (g) the date on which the notice is issued.

        • (2) The detention expires 12 months after the day on which the notice is issued, but it may be revoked earlier, in writing, by the inspector.

        • (3) A person may request a review of the detention at any time after it takes effect and the notice has been issued to the person who has the charge, management or control of the dangerous goods or means of containment. The request must be made in writing to the Minister and must include the following information:

          • (a) the name and address of the place of business of the person requesting the review;

          • (b) a copy of the notice;

          • (c) the reasons why the detention should be revoked; and

          • (d) all of the information necessary to support the request for review.

        • 16.4 (1) An inspector who, under subsection 17(2) of the Act, directs a person to take measures necessary to remedy non-compliance with the Act must issue a notice of direction to that person. The notice must include the following information:

          • (a) a description of any non-compliance, including the applicable references to the Act and these Regulations;

          • (b) a description of the measures in the inspector’s direction;

          • (c) the name and contact information of the person to whom the notice is issued;

          • (d) the name, certificate of designation number and signature of the inspector issuing the notice;

          • (e) the geographic location where the notice is issued; and

          • (f) the date on which the notice is issued.

        • (2) Before a notice is issued to the person directed by the inspector to take necessary measures under subsection (1), the notice must be signed and dated by one of the following Department of Transport officials:

          • (a) the Director, Compliance Support Branch, Transportation of Dangerous Goods Program Hub;

          • (b) the Supervisor of the Inspector, Transportation of Dangerous Goods Program Hub; or

          • (c) the Chief, Oversight Advisory Team.

        • (3) The direction expires 12 months after the day on which the notice is issued, but it may be revoked earlier, in writing, by the inspector.

        • (4) A person may request a review of the direction at any time after it takes effect and the notice has been issued to the person who has the charge, management or control of the dangerous goods or means of containment. The request must be made in writing to the Minister and must include the following information:

          • (a) the name and address of the place of business of the person requesting the review;

          • (b) a copy of the notice;

          • (c) the reasons why the direction should be revoked; and

          • (d) all of the information necessary to support the request for review.

        • 16.5 (1) An inspector who, under subsection 17(3) of the Act, directs that dangerous goods or a means of containment not be imported into Canada or that they be returned to their place of origin must issue a notice of direction to the person who has the charge, management or control of the dangerous goods or means of containment. The notice must include the following information:

          • (a) the UN number and shipping name of any dangerous goods subject to the notice;

          • (b) a description of any means of containment and, if applicable, the serial number of the means of containment;

          • (c) a description of any non-compliance, including the relevant references to the Act and these Regulations, as well as the reasons why measures to remedy the non-compliance are not possible or desirable;

          • (d) the name and contact information of the person to whom the notice is issued;

          • (e) the name, certificate of designation number and signature of the inspector issuing the notice;

          • (f) the geographic location where the notice is issued; and

          • (g) the date on which the notice is issued.

        • (2) The direction expires 12 months after the day on which the notice is issued, but it may be revoked earlier, in writing, by the inspector.

        • (3) A person may request a review of the direction at any time after it takes effect and the notice has been issued to the person who has the charge, management or control of the dangerous goods or means of containment. The request must be made in writing to the Minister and must include the following information:

          • (a) the name and address of the place of business of the person requesting the review;

          • (b) a copy of the notice;

          • (c) the reasons why the direction should be revoked; and

          • (d) all of the information necessary to support the request for review.

    • 107 Schedule 2 to the Regulations is amended by adding the following after special provision 183:

      • 184 When offered for transport as pesticides, these dangerous goods must be imported, offered for transport, handled or transported under the relevant pesticide entry set out in Appendix A of the UN Recommendations.

        UN1544, UN1556, UN1557, UN1570, UN1598, UN1621, UN1651, UN1655, UN1656, UN1674, UN1686, UN1704, UN1707, UN2024 to UN2027, UN2788, UN3140, UN3144, UN3146, UN3155, UN3278, UN3279, UN3444, UN3464

      • 185 The group of alkali metals includes lithium, sodium, potassium, rubidium and caesium.

        UN1389 to UN1391, UN1421, UN3206, UN3401, UN3482

      • 186 The group of alkaline earth metals includes magnesium, calcium, strontium and barium.

        UN1391, UN1392, UN3205, UN3402, UN3482

      • 187 These Regulations, except Parts 1 and 2, do not apply to UN2857, REFRIGERATING MACHINES or refrigerating machine components if the machines or components contain less than 12 kg of gas included in Class 2.2 or less than 12 L of UN2672, AMMONIA SOLUTION.

      UN2857

      • 188 These Regulations, except Parts 1 and 2, do not apply to an aqueous solution containing not more than 24% alcohol by volume.

      UN1170
